Hi Everyone,

Dunno if you wish to see updates on the hordes? That is what the Poll is about.

The Blue Horde has been reconstituted on BOINC (optimized BOINC clients) with at least 70 computers -- probably a lot more with a wide mix between 900MHz PIII up to and including 2.8GHz P4 (Some HT) and some miscellaneous Athlons (1GHZ or faster).

The Golden Hordes has had many hardware failures of late and is significantly impaired compared with former FaD days. BOINC (optimized) has been installed on about a dozen computers -- ranging from a Dual PIII/850 up to an Athlon XP2400+. Computers awaiting repair include an Athlon XP3000+ Mobile, several Athlon XP2000+, and an Opteron 170.

The White Horde has been reconstituted with BOINC running on about a dozen P4 2.4+ computers.

A new Horde will arise within a few days with about 25 or so P4 2.4+ computers.

The hordes seem to have made an overwhelming on SIMAP. I've risen to #1 on the SIMAP Team and #5 overall.

The hordes are making themselves felt to a much lesser extent in SETI. I've risen into the top 80 on the SETI Team and expect to be in the Top 40 within a month or less. I've risen into the top 30,000 or so overall. [Sorry ... Fat Fingered This]

PrimeGrid was added as a project on 1 Jan and should show some completions within a day or two and I hope that some impact in that project will become obvious as well.

Thanks for your support Team!

mondo

All these clients are running SETI (45%), SIMAP (45%), and PrimeGrid (10%).
